2022 KHR to CDF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the KHR to CDF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on September 17, valuing the pair at 0.5018.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on August 19, dropping to 0.4860.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0158 CDF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.4927 to the December average rate of 0.4968, the exchange rate registered a net change of 0.85%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 0.5018 was up 0.95% compared to the 2021 peak of 0.4971,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
